Output 588386aea87a683e7c0629cf92cb85d2e548db23cfa867e9a5d385b4df6abc79:9

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 420ef3385db46873099afa282a1bd3fec821a1c32bd196319fc8ecf9f5b3792c
address
tb1pgg80xwzak358xzv6lg5z5x7nlmyzrgwr90gevvvlerk0nadn0ykqkrew63
transaction
588386aea87a683e7c0629cf92cb85d2e548db23cfa867e9a5d385b4df6abc79
confirmations
59764
spent
true